Most new agents receive a large amount of content up front. They may get product manuals, training videos, carrier details, and compliance information, but no guidance on what matters first. Without prioritization, the information becomes noise instead of progress.
For people who are new to insurance, it might be hard to understand. Without systematic coaching that describes goods in normal language, novice agents pause during customer discussions and avoid quoting for fear of making mistakes.
Confidence comes from practice and clarity. Without either one, new agents often freeze, speak too quickly, or rely heavily on scripts that do not feel natural. This leads to missed opportunities.
Many new agents do not know how to generate leads, start outreach, or build a pipeline. They rely on hope rather than a repeatable system.
Some organizations offer an introduction and then leave new agents to figure things out alone. Without continuous guidance, most new agents slow down and struggle to catch up.
